Today, Anker is releasing its new Nano Power Strip, initially unveiled at CES 2026. It clamps onto the side of your desk and offers 10 ports, making it a great add for managing power without a load of mess. It’s available for purchase starting today.

If you’re using your Mac at your desk, whether that be a docked MacBook or a proper desktop setup, you probably have a lot of wires running from your floor up to your desk. That can get messy, and cable management isn’t easy.

Instead of needing to run loads of long wires, the new Anker Nano Power Strip brings your cables onto your desk, getting rid of your tangled cables underneath. You can slide it wherever you see fit, then clamp it on with the adjustable knob on the bottom. It’ll fit onto desks up to 1.8″ thick.

It offers 4 ports on the front: two USB-A and two USB-C, with the two USB-C ports supporting up to 70W on one port, or 45W/25W if you’re using both ports. There’s also 6 AC outlets for plugging in your own monitors, chargers, docks, or whatever else you need on your desk. There’s two on the top, two on the side, and two on the bottom. It also offers 1500J of surge protection.

Personally, I’ve found the Anker Nano Power Strip quite useful for decluttering my desk, primarily for getting rid of unnecessary power bricks thanks to its built in ports. I’ve also used shorter cables where possible, preventing a lot of cable overhang. It’s nice and slim, so once you set it up, its rather out of the way.
